Analysis

The most recent figure for sweet potatoes — producer price in New Caledonia is 3,485 USD, measured in 2022.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 18.2% on the previous year and up 4.1% over ten years.

That places New Caledonia 2nd out of 71 countries with data for 2022, putting it in the top 10%.

Sweet potatoes — Producer Price in New Caledonia, year by year

Annual values for Sweet potatoes — Producer Price (USD/tonne) in New Caledonia, 2015 to 2022.
Year USD Change
2015 3,347 USD
2016 3,238 USD -3.2%
2017 3,779 USD +16.7%
2018 3,892 USD +3.0%
2019 3,542 USD -9.0%
2020 3,806 USD +7.4%
2021 4,261 USD +12.0%
2022 3,485 USD -18.2%

This sub-domain contains data on agriculture producer prices and the producer price index. Agriculture producer prices are prices received by farmers for primary crops, live animals and livestock primary products as collected at the point of initial sale (prices paid at the farm gate). Annual data are provided from 1991 (while mothly data start in January 2010) for 180 countries and 212 products. The producer price index is the index of agricultural producer prices that measures the average annual change over time in the selling prices received by farmers (prices at the farm gate or at the first point of sale). The three categories of producer price index available in FAOSTAT comprise: single-item price index, commodity group index and the agriculture producer price index.
